"Joanne Cherefko makes a visceral, emotional connection with her readers. Her blistering and brilliant poems are filled with a lush bleakness that is both moving and universal." - Rich Follett, author of Silence, Inhabited, Responsorials, and Human &c.Joanne Cherefko's debut collection, A Consecration of the Wind, charts the poet's tentative journey from loss and isolation to salvation through love. She deftly weaves startling imagery of inner and outer landscapes, divided selves, and a vulnerability that permeates the collection. Her most complex poems embrace the surreal atmosphere of sleepless nights as a motherless daughter swirled "in a raptureless cocoon" of angst and despair as she attempts renewal "in waters stagnant with resolve."Other poems provide a narrative of her life as a single woman navigating the pitfalls of dating ("Trolling at the Jersey Shore") and finding love, despite "How dark and blue/And unpredictable/Her waterways were/And how susceptible they were/To lightning and hail."

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
